Tesco

Tesco is an international supermarket chain. It sells a variety of items. It is one of the largest chains in UK and has over 3700 stores. The stores vary from megastores to smaller shops. It also provides home delivery and online shopping. It is also dedicated to offering its customers cheap prices every day. It also offers loyalty discounts on certain items.

Tesco started its business in 1919, when Jack Cohen set up a small market stall in London's East End. He wanted customers to pick their own products. It was a huge success and he then expanded the business. He began selling his products to other businesses.

The company has expanded its business to include clothing, books and electronic devices, furniture and financial services. Its stores include huge hypermarkets, discount stores and convenience stores. Its supermarkets carry a wide assortment of fresh items including dairy products, meat bakery, frozen food, and ready meals. Also, they have toiletries and beauty products.

Tesco opened the first US stores in 2007 under the name Fresh & Easy. The company had hoped to create a coast to coast business and had constructed a huge infrastructure. Tesco announced in 2013 that it was going out of the United States.

The decision to pull out of the US market was made after careful consideration and thorough research. Tesco has invested more than $1 billion in the US operations. The company spent 20 years planning its move into the American marketplace. It recruited Dunhumby as a customer-science company and sent its executives to American homes to observe how families were eating and where they shop.
